## Understanding the Importance of Sleep


### 1. **The Science Behind Sleep and Skin Health**


During deep sleep, your body focuses on repair and regeneration. Cell turnover increases, collagen production rises, and hydration levels stabilize. This means that not only does your skin repair itself, but it also becomes more receptive to the products you apply. A good night’s sleep helps reduce the appearance of fine lines, dark circles, and dullness, leading to a more youthful and vibrant complexion.


### 2. **Sleep Duration Matters**


Most adults need 7-9 hours of quality sleep per night. Insufficient sleep can lead to increased cortisol levels, which can trigger breakouts and exacerbate skin conditions like eczema. Prioritizing your sleep can significantly impact your skin’s appearance, mood, and energy levels.


## Creating Your Nightly Routine


### 3. **Set a Regular Sleep Schedule**


Consistency is key. Try to go to bed and wake up at the same time every day, even on weekends. This helps regulate your body’s internal clock, making it easier to fall asleep and wake up refreshed.


### 4. **Create a Relaxing Environment**


Your bedroom should be a sanctuary for sleep. Here are a few tips to optimize your environment:


- **Dim the Lights:** Reduce brightness an hour before bed. This signals to your body that it’s time to wind down.

- **Cool the Room:** A cooler temperature (around 60-67°F) is optimal for sleep. Consider using a fan or opening a window.

- **Limit Noise:** Use earplugs or a white noise machine to drown out disruptive sounds.


### 5. **Establish a Pre-Sleep Routine**


Creating a calming pre-sleep routine can signal your body that it’s time to relax. Here are some ideas:


- **Limit Screen Time:** Avoid screens (phones, tablets, TVs) at least 30 minutes before bed. The blue light emitted can interfere with melatonin production, making it harder to fall asleep.

- **Read a Book:** Choose a light, enjoyable read to help you unwind.

- **Practice Mindfulness:** Engage in calming activities like meditation, deep breathing, or gentle stretching to ease your mind and body.


## Skincare Rituals for Nighttime Radiance


### 6. **Cleanse Thoroughly**


Before bed, it’s crucial to remove any makeup, dirt, and impurities that have accumulated throughout the day. A clean slate allows your skin to breathe and absorb products effectively. Choose a gentle cleanser that suits your skin type, and follow with a double cleanse if you wear heavy makeup or sunscreen.


### 7. **Exfoliate (2-3 Times a Week)**


Exfoliating a few times a week helps to remove dead skin cells, revealing fresh, glowing skin beneath. Opt for a gentle chemical exfoliant (like AHAs or BHAs) or a mild physical scrub. However, avoid over-exfoliating, as it can lead to irritation.


### 8. **Apply Targeted Treatments**


Nighttime is the perfect opportunity to apply targeted treatments for specific skin concerns. Consider these options:


- **Serums:** Use a serum rich in antioxidants (like vitamin C) for brightening, or one containing hyaluronic acid for deep hydration.

- **Retinol:** If you’re looking to reduce fine lines and improve texture, retinol can be highly effective. Start with a low concentration to allow your skin to adjust.


### 9. **Moisturize**


Follow up your treatments with a good moisturizer. Night creams are usually thicker and more hydrating, perfect for nourishing your skin while you sleep. Look for ingredients like:


- **Ceramides:** Help restore the skin barrier and retain moisture.

- **Peptides:** Support collagen production and improve skin elasticity.

- **Natural Oils:** Oils like jojoba, almond, or rosehip provide deep hydration and nourishment.


### 10. **Don’t Forget Your Eyes**


The delicate skin around your eyes deserves special attention. Consider using an eye cream formulated with ingredients like:


- **Caffeine:** Helps reduce puffiness and dark circles.

- **Peptides:** Support skin repair and firmness.


### 11. **Hydrate Internally**


While external skincare is crucial, don’t forget about hydration from within. Drink a glass of water before bed to help keep your skin plump. Consider herbal teas like chamomile or peppermint, which can promote relaxation and improve sleep quality.


## Lifestyle Factors to Enhance Beauty Sleep


### 12. **Watch Your Diet**


Your evening meals can impact your sleep quality and skin health. Consider these tips:


- **Avoid Heavy Meals:** Try to have your last meal at least 2-3 hours before bed to avoid discomfort.

- **Limit Sugar and Caffeine:** These can disrupt your sleep patterns and contribute to skin issues like breakouts.

- **Incorporate Skin-Boosting Foods:** Foods rich in antioxidants, healthy fats, and vitamins (like berries, avocados, and nuts) can improve your skin's appearance.


### 13. **Limit Alcohol Intake**


While alcohol may initially make you feel sleepy, it disrupts the sleep cycle and can lead to dehydration. Try to limit alcohol consumption, especially close to bedtime, to ensure a more restful night.


### 14. **Regular Exercise**


Engaging in regular physical activity can improve sleep quality and reduce stress, both of which benefit your skin. Aim for at least 30 minutes of moderate exercise most days, but avoid vigorous workouts right before bed, as they may energize you too much.


### 15. **Manage Stress**


Chronic stress can lead to hormonal imbalances, triggering skin issues like acne and eczema. Incorporate stress management techniques such as yoga, meditation, or journaling into your daily routine to promote overall well-being and improve skin health.


## The Role of Beauty Tools


### 16. **Incorporate Beauty Tools**


Using beauty tools can enhance your nightly routine. Consider:


- **Facial Rollers:** These tools can help with lymphatic drainage and reduce puffiness.

- **Gua Sha:** This ancient Chinese technique can improve circulation and promote a lifted appearance.


### 17. **Silk Pillowcases**


Switching to a silk pillowcase can help reduce friction on your skin and hair, preventing sleep lines and frizz. Silk is also less absorbent than cotton, allowing your skincare products to work more effectively.
